3.1 MAGIC SYSTEMS AND LANGUAGE
At its heart, a magic system is a language. is is true of ctional, game,
and occult systems alike, though the nature of the medium and purpose
denes the character of the language. Various systems can be more and
less explicit and self-aware of their linguistic status, but they are always
fundamentally linguistic. Because magic systems are languages, they have
both vocabularies and grammars: a set of symbols and rules for combin-
ing them. e simplest grammatical structure is the verb: do this action,
